Transaction 474329fb003e7400261a77c996fe3a1c354480787f80ae584a12eb04e1682192
1 Input
2 Outputs
- 474329fb003e7400261a77c996fe3a1c354480787f80ae584a12eb04e1682192:0
- 474329fb003e7400261a77c996fe3a1c354480787f80ae584a12eb04e1682192:1
value 9950000
address 1CwwVDs55esxCUzwxKjUDJr1K9QsmEQTeY
value 2390038650
address 14eVUKLVwdj6Ri5oodn6Gvf5jLtrD1sLM7